Spain has a "good, solid, evergreen" property market, despite high prices, the director of property advice site Amberlamb has said.
According to Rhiannon Williamson, because Spain is so easily accessible and has "excellent" fundamentals, such as a stable economy, investors continue to be attracted to the country.
However, she conceded that the large amounts of available rental property and high prices have meant that some investors have become anxious about reduced rental yields.
"The problem with Spain is that it has had its property market boom and prices in the most popular locations are already high," she remarked.
However, buying a well-located property should generate a steady rental income for the savvy investor, she added.
Online firm Spanish Property Insight recently said that Spain is set to become the number one European destination for UK investors.
